Striking Gold: Ark Mines Uncovers High-Grade Results at Pluton Project
Ark Mines Limited (ASX: AHK) has announced exceptional gold grades from its recent wet season sampling program at the Pluton Gold Project in North Queensland, with rock chip samples yielding up to 25 g/t gold and 34 g/t silver.
Record-Breaking Gold Grades Validate Project Potential
The exploratory rock chip sampling program has delivered remarkable results that not only validate historic work but exceed previous findings. The 30 rock chip samples returned:
- Maximum gold grade of 24.96 g/t, significantly higher than the 9.94 g/t recorded in 2005
- Average gold grade of 3.4 g/t across all samples
- Maximum silver grade of 33.7 g/t with an average of 7.1 g/t
These impressive results provide strong evidence that the Pluton Project at Ark Mines Ltd hosts significant precious metal mineralisation with substantial economic potential.
"What's not to love about 25 grams per tonne? Even the 3 gram per tonne sample average is very nice. There's a lot of work still to be done at Pluton and we don't want it to distract from Sandy Mitchell and the great story Ark is developing there, but Pluton has potential that we can't ignore and makes a good wet season field option." – Ben Emery, Executive Director

What is an Intrusion-Related Gold (IRG) System?
IRG systems represent a distinct class of gold deposits that form when hot, metal-rich fluids associated with cooling granitic magma migrate through surrounding rocks. These systems typically develop along the margins of intrusive bodies or within the intrusions themselves. The process creates zones where gold and other elements become concentrated enough to form potentially economic deposits.
IRG systems typically feature:
- Gold mineralisation associated with granitic intrusions
- Strong geochemical pathfinder elements (arsenic, bismuth, tellurium)
- Multiple stages of mineralisation that can create rich gold zones

The pathfinder correlations identified at the Pluton Project indicate a classic IRG signature, with gold positively correlating with arsenic, copper, selenium, tellurium, bismuth, and sulfur.
This geological setting explains why the project shows such promising grades and provides a scientific basis for the company's exploration strategy.
Exploration Insights from Geochemical Signatures
The sampling program has revealed key pathfinder correlations that will guide future exploration:
Element Relationships | Correlation | Significance |
---|---|---|
Gold with As, Cu, Se, Te, Bi, S | Positive | Classic IRG signature |
Gold with Sn, W, Pb, Zn | Negative | Differentiation from other mineralising events |
Silver with Pb, Zn, Hg, Se, S | Positive | Indicates distinct but overlapping mineralisation |
These relationships suggest multiple mineralising events have occurred at the Pluton Project at Ark Mines Ltd, potentially creating zones of enriched precious metals where these systems overlap. The consistent pathfinder correlations also provide Ark Mines with valuable targeting tools for follow-up exploration.
Expanding the Exploration Footprint
A critical discovery from this program is that mineralisation extends beyond the previously identified breccia zones. This significantly expands the exploration target area and suggests that structural controls may play a more important role in gold distribution than previously thought.
The project area lies within the Devonian Hodgkinson Formation sediments, which are intruded by Carboniferous granites. Previous drilling by Malachite Resources identified a sericitised quartz porphyry at depths of 12-29m that wasn't visible in surface outcrops. Ark's findings suggest this intrusion may be more extensive and influential on gold mineralisation than previously recognised.
Next Steps: Systematic Exploration Program
Ark Mines has outlined a focused exploration strategy to advance the Pluton Project. The company will conduct thorough mining feasibility studies to determine the economic viability as they progress. Their approach includes:
- Additional niche rock chip sampling across the Hodgkinson Formation outcrop and surrounding areas
- Preliminary soil orientation survey in the Tertiary to Quaternary colluvium adjacent to the Hodgkinson Formation
- Follow-up gridded soil sampling to identify covered targets
- Integration of structural mapping to better understand mineralisation controls
